How much do workampers make?

Workampers in live-in RV work camps typically earn an hourly wage ranging from $10 to $15, with some positions offering stipends or bonuses. Many roles also provide free or discounted housing and access to amenities, which can offset lower pay rates.

Can you get a job living in an RV?

A Live In RV Work Camp position involves working while living in an RV provided by the employer, often in seasonal or remote work environments. These jobs typically require skills related to hospitality, maintenance, or outdoor work and may include flexible schedules. Employment is usually contingent on meeting job-specific requirements and may involve background checks or certifications.

What is the difference between Live In Rv Work Camp vs Live In Rv Camp Counselor?

AspectLive In Rv Work CampLive In Rv Camp Counselor
Required CredentialsVaries; often no formal certification neededMay require experience with children or outdoor activities
Work EnvironmentRemote outdoor settings, seasonal campsChild-focused, outdoor or recreational settings
Employer & Industry UsageCamp operators, seasonal employmentSummer camps, youth programs
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ding camp work optionsWorking with children in outdoor settings

Both roles involve living in RVs at camp sites, but Live In Rv Work Camps generally focus on maintenance, logistics, or general camp support, while Live In Rv Camp Counselors primarily work with children and youth programs. The choice depends on your skills and interests in outdoor work or youth supervision.
